About Westover Green Community School and Autism Centre

Westover Green Community School and Autism Centre is a state-funded Does not apply primary school serving the Somerset community, welcoming children from age 4 to 11. The school has 409 pupils on roll and is near full capacity (97% of 420 places).

Ofsted has rated Westover Green Community School and Autism Centre "Good", the school is led by headteacher Jo Hale, it falls under Somerset local authority.

In terms of academic performance, 53% of pupils met the expected standard in Reading, Writing and Maths at KS2 — below the national average. Additionally, ranked 10010th out of 13,686 schools in England. Additionally, 84th out of 134 in Somerset.

Westover Green Community School and Autism Centre is a popular choice with families — it received 55 applications for 36 places, making it 1.5x oversubscribed. Of these, 30 were first-preference applications.

For children with special educational needs, the school offers support across 9 areas, including Specific Learning Difficulty (Dyslexia), Moderate Learning Difficulty, Social, Emotional & Mental Health and 6 more. Parents should contact the school's SENCO for specific details about provision.

On-site facilities at Westover Green Community School and Autism Centre include Library, Art Studios, Sensory Room, Playing Fields, Dining Hall, Sports Hall, Forest School, Chapel.

Beyond the classroom, pupils can take part in sports such as Cross Country, Athletics, Football, Rounders and 3 more, as well as clubs including Science Club, Coding, Film Club, Chess and 1 more.

The proportion of pupils eligible for free school meals is 46.5%, which is well above the national average for primary schools in England.
